Group I
Read the text carefully.

Paul Clark, a young boy, lives with his parents in London. He is tall
and slim and he’s got short brown hair. Mr Clark, Paul’s father, is a doctor
and Mrs Clark, Paul’s mother, is an architect. She’s forty-three. They have
a very busy life but they like their jobs very much. Every day they get up
early to go to work. Before Mr Clark goes to the hospital, he drives his
wife to her office and his son to school.
Today is Sunday and the family is at home. At the weekend, they usually do outdoor
activities but not today, because Mr and Mrs Clark are very tired and Paul must study. He has got a
Maths test tomorrow.
Right now, Mrs Clark is watching TV. Her husband is reading a book and Paul is studying in
his bedroom.
